1

このhtmlに適用するhtmlページとcssがあります。

HTML コード

<label>id</label>              <span>1</span>
<label>Name</label>            <span>My name is</span>
<label>Address</label>         <span>Address, Address 2, Address 3, UK</span>

CSSコード

label{
    min-width: 200px;
    float: left;
}
span{
    margin-left:5px;
}

HTMLをこのように表示したい

Id:              1
Name:            My name is
Address:         Address, Address 2, Address 3, UK

しかし、私のコードはこのように表示されます。

Id:              1
Name:            My name 
is
Address:         Address, Address 2, 
Address 3, UK

これを修正するにはどうすればよいですか。

4

2 に答える 2

1

display:block; を追加してみてください。and white-space:nowrap; スパンCSSに。jsfiddle

ただし、テーブルを使用して調査する必要があると思います。データを表示する場合は、テーブルが適しています。

于 2013-10-18T18:38:30.133 に答える
0

Divでラップしますか?cssdesk.com で試してみたところ、うまくいきました。

<div><label>id</label><span>1</span></div>
<div><label>Name</label><span>My name is</span></div>
<div><label>Address</label><span>Address, Address 2, Address 3, UK</span></div>
于 2013-10-18T19:45:43.600 に答える